On Fri, Dec 01, 2023 at 10:13:09AM +0800, Oliver Sang wrote:

> > Very interesting...  Out of curiosity, what effect would the following
> > have on top of 1b738f196e?
> 
> I applied the patch upon 1b738f196e (as below fec356fd0c), but seems less
> useful.

I would be rather surprised if it fixed anything; it's just that 1b738f196e
changes two things - locking rules for __dentry_kill() and, in some cases,
the order of dentry eviction in shrink_dentry_list().  That delta on top of
it restores the original order in shrink_dentry_list(), leaving pretty much
the changes in lock_for_kill()/dput()/__dentry_kill().

Interesting...  Looks like there are serious changes in context switch
frequencies, but I don't see where could that have come from...
